What is the still wind frequency in the wind rose diagram?

Static wind frequency: the frequency of static wind, that is, Beaufort zero wind. Generally, the wind speed is 0-0.2m/s, and the plume is often straight. Meteorological conditions in which the average wind speed above the ground 10m is less than 0.2m/s.

The wind rose diagram is a statistical graph that represents the airflow repetition rate in all directions in the form of "roses". The data used can be within one month or one year, but the average statistical data of a region for many years is usually used, and its types are generally wind direction rose chart and wind speed rose chart.

Wind direction rose chart, also known as wind frequency chart, is a closed line chart that divides the wind direction into eight directions or 16 directions, intercepts the corresponding length on each direction line according to the wind frequency in each direction, and connects the cutting points on adjacent direction lines with straight lines (as shown in figure 1). In Figure 1, the wind direction with the maximum wind frequency in this area is the north wind, which is about 20% (each interval represents 5% of the wind direction frequency);

The number in the middle circle represents the frequency of still wind.

If the average wind speed in all directions is expressed in this way, it becomes a rose diagram of wind speed.

There are other forms of wind rose diagram, as shown in Figure 2 ~ Figure 5, in which Figure 3 is a rose diagram of wind frequency and wind speed, and each direction reflects both the wind frequency (the length of the line segment) and the average wind speed in that direction (the number of wind feathers at the end of the line segment); Figure 4-5 is a simplified diagram of the wind rose diagram without quantification, and the length of the line segment indicates the relative magnitude of the wind frequency.

In short, which direction is long means which direction has high incoming wind frequency.

The wind rose map is an important part of public meteorological service, which plays an important role in building planning, environmental protection, wind power generation, fire protection, oil station design, marine climate analysis and other fields.

1, urban planning

Air pollutants produced by industrial enterprises are mainly diluted and diffused by gas movement. The frequency of wind direction indicates the number of blows in a certain wind direction and shows the pollution opportunity in the downstream area of a certain wind direction. Downstream areas with high frequency have more pollution opportunities, and vice versa. Therefore, industries with waste gas pollution are usually arranged on the side of the minimum wind frequency in the wind rose diagram; ?

Wind speed determines the diffusion speed of pollutants. The greater the speed, the longer the waste gas discharged from the factory, the more air mixed in, and the smaller the concentration of pollutants. On the contrary, the lower the speed, the greater the concentration of pollutants, so industries with waste gas pollution should be arranged in the direction of high wind speed.

The wind rose map reflects the important information of meteorological element wind. Based on this information, wind pollution theory can effectively guide urban planning and industrial layout, and can also be used to analyze the rationality of urban land use.

2. Environmental protection

Air pollutants are diluted by wind diffusion, so evaluating the impact of a pollution source on the surrounding environment or evaluating the pollution situation in a certain place is related to the local wind conditions.

The wind rose diagram is more vivid and intuitive, and the pollution probability rose diagram and pollution coefficient rose diagram are derived, which are widely used in pollution meteorology and air pollution evaluation.

3. Wind power generation

Wind Rose Diagram is an essential step in the early stage of wind farm construction-the main tool of "wind energy resource assessment".

4. Fire fighting

The wind rose diagram is an indispensable tool for the fire supervision department to carry out construction and audit work according to the relevant national fire technical specifications, which is generally provided by the local meteorological department.
